溫馨提示×

sql oracle性能優化的最佳實踐是什么

小樊
107
2024-06-25 14:41:28
欄目: 云計算

在Oracle數據庫中進行性能優化的最佳實踐包括以下幾個方面:

  1. 使用索引:為經常使用的列創建索引,以加快查詢速度。確保索引的選擇和設計是合理的,并定期對索引進行優化和重新構建。

  2. 優化SQL查詢:編寫高效的SQL查詢,避免使用SELECT *、避免在WHERE子句中使用函數、盡量避免使用全表掃描等操作。

  3. 避免大事務和長時間事務:使用小事務和短時間事務,避免長時間占用數據庫資源,避免死鎖和性能下降。

  4. 使用合適的數據類型:選擇合適的數據類型,避免使用過大或過小的數據類型,以提高查詢效率。

  5. 使用適當的緩存:合理配置數據庫緩存,包括SGA緩沖池、PGA緩沖池等,以提高性能和減少IO操作。

  6. 定期監測和調優:定期監測數據庫性能,包括查詢性能、磁盤IO性能、內存利用率等,及時發現問題并進行調優。

以上是一些常用的Oracle數據庫性能優化實踐,可以根據具體情況進行適當調整和擴展。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女